Were looking for a payroll specialist to join our team here at Starbucks on a 6 month FTC. A place where youre valued, challenged, and inspired. Where your voice is brewed into everything we do. At Starbucks, were all about you.
As part of this role, youll be responsible for processing accurate and timely payments for hourly pad and salaried partners (employees) on a four weekly pay cycle.
Well look to you to bring your experience of large volume payroll in a fast-paced, multi-site environment. Youll have strong knowledge of UK payroll legislation with the ability to demonstrate manual calculations of tax, NI and statutory payments. Well also love to hear about your strong knowledge of Excel, alongside ideally having experience of working with SAP Global View and ADP. Ideally youll be CIPP (or equivalent) qualified, but more importantly youll have the ability to work to tight deadlines, be able to troubleshoot processes and look at ways we can continuously improve our processes.
The best part about this role is that no two days are ever the same! Working as our payroll specialist, youll get involved in:
Preparation of the retail store payroll, liaising with the wider HR team to ensure all personal and payroll data is collated and input using Partner Central.
Working with ADP to resolve any discrepancies that may be encountered during each payroll period.
Processing and validating the 4 weekly Quinyx timecard data from retail stores and ensuring all data is received by the payroll deadlines.
Managing payroll queries and time data corrections from retail stores and support centre teams. Liaising with stakeholders as required to actively support in root cause solutions to reduce the number of payroll queries.
Collating payroll data on a 4 weekly basis, including calculating and processing statutory payments of SMP, SPP, SSP and company sick pay.As well as processing Tax, NI and benefit scheme deductions.
Updating and maintaining personnel and payroll records within Partner Central and ADP Global View, including processing and inputting tax documents, P45s and new starter documents.
Maintaining payroll process documents, ensuring payroll compliance and all pay policies are updated accordingly.
Ensuring accurate maintenance of statutory data through regular data cleansing and running reports to identify potential issues and rectifying any discrepancies.
Calculating and payment of off-cycle payments (advances, holiday pay, termination payments).
Assisting the payroll manager with period end routines, including preparation and reconciliation of payroll balance sheet accounts and finance monthly reporting requirements, keeping accurate records of resolutions for audit purposes.
Collating data to ensure the correct calculation of pension contributions under Auto Enrolment.
Liaising with third parties to enable the transfer of information between different systems.
Communicating with Starbucks outsourced payroll provider to ensure that the results are included in the appropriate payroll run, with changes to pension auto enrolment status processed in an accurate and timely manner
Support in delivering payroll business projects, including data gathering, process design, testing and reporting.
Ensuring all third party payments are made in a timely and accurate manner
